The Study On Emergence And Accumlation Of Resistant Aeromonas Hydrophila In Vitro Model By Different Dosing Regimen With Enrofloxacin

Abstract/Summary:
It was a challenge to dicide a dosing regimen because of the complex relationship among bactera,host and the concentration of drug in the body of host. It made something unreasonable to decide a dosing regimen only on the basis of parameters of pharmacokinetics and pharmacodynamics.The mutation selection windows provided a new way to prevent or slow down the emergence of drug-resistance bacteria,and a new requirement to the decision of dosing regimen of antimicrobial and the new drug research and development.MSW wasn’t complete to guide the decision of a dosing regimen for the study for it was new,and there were to much gaps.So the MSWs of several frequently-used aveterinary drugs on A. hydrophila were determined by in vitro method.And how the drug-resistance bacteria emerged and accumlated in vitro model was studied,to provide information and thinking to decide a reasonable dosing regimen.The result shows that the MIC99S of kanamycin for A. hydrophila were2.000.1.200.1.200.1.200.1.600μ g/mL,MPCs were16.000.4.800,9.600.25.600.9.600μg/mL;the MIC99S of enrofloxacin for A. hydrophila were0.125.0.150.0.150.0.100.0.100μg/mL,MPCs were1.600.0.800.1.600.1.200.1.800μg/mL;the MIC99S of florfenicol for A hydrophila were8.000.19.200.9.600.9.600.9.600μ g/mL,MPCs were128μ g/mL.In the vitro model,bacteria were killed under a dosing regimen,or the drug-resistance bacteria emerged.The drug-resistance bacteria emerged earlier with higher dosing under the direction of same dosing interval and rate of elimination,and so did it with greater rate of elimination under the direction of same dosing interval and dosing, and so did it with longer dosing interval under the direction of same rate of elimination and dosing.The strength of resistance accumulative increased as time went by.The strength of resistance came stronger with the time extension. After the analysis of the correlation between pharmacokinetic parameters and AUBKCs,the T>MIC wasn’t very well correlated to AUBKC;but Cmax/MIC and AUC24/MIC were with no difference by logarithm.Analysis suggests that the emergence and accumlation of drug-resistance bacteria is affected by dosing regimen and pharmacokinetic characteristics.It may involve the evolutionary mechanism of bacteria,and how it works is still need more research to do.
